介绍
随着互联网的普及,网络封锁和监控也越来越严格。Shadowsocks 是一种用于绕过网络封锁的工具,而树莓派则是一款便宜且功能强大的微型电脑。本指南将教你如何在树莓派上搭建Shadowsocks 服务器,实现科学上网和保护隐私。
步骤
步骤一:准备工作
- 购买树莓派
- 下载并安装树莓派操作系统
- 连接树莓派到网络
步骤二:安装Shadowsocks
-
打开终端,输入以下命令安装Shadowsocks:
bash sudo apt update sudo apt install shadowsocks-libev
-
配置Shadowsocks服务器:
bash sudo nano /etc/shadowsocks-libev/config.json
在打开的文件中,输入以下配置信息:
{ “server”:”your_server_ip”, “server_port”:8388, “password”:”your_password”, “method”:”chacha20-ietf-poly1305″ }
替换
your_server_ip
和your_password
为你自己的服务器IP地址和密码。 -
保存并退出编辑器,然后启动Shadowsocks服务器:
bash sudo systemctl start shadowsocks-libev
步骤三:测试连接
使用Shadowsocks客户端,在你的设备上配置代理,连接到你的Shadowsocks服务器,确保连接正常。
常见问题解答
如何添加多个用户?
你可以在Shadowsocks配置文件中添加多个用户,每个用户使用不同的端口和密码。
如何升级Shadowsocks?
使用以下命令更新Shadowsocks软件:
bash sudo apt update sudo apt upgrade shadowsocks-libev
如何配置Shadowsocks自动启动?
使用以下命令将Shadowsocks添加到系统启动项中:
bash sudo systemctl enable shadowsocks-libev
如何查看Shadowsocks服务器运行状态?
使用以下命令查看Shadowsocks服务器运行状态:
bash sudo systemctl status shadowsocks-libev
结论
通过本指南,你已经学会了在树莓派上搭建Shadowsocks服务器的方法。现在,你可以自由访问被封锁的网站,保护你的网络隐私了。